EPIC Position Description Title: Account Service Manager
As an Account Service Manager, you will serve as the relationship manager and account professional for brokers and/or strategic clients on pharmacy benefit related topics. You will collaborate with the Pharmacy Benefit Consultant by interacting and creating relationships with brokers, client executives, human resource personnel, and others which will enable EPIC to partner with clients to create and communicate within the context of the overall health and welfare strategy. As the Account Service Manager, you are the guru when it comes to planning benefits, auditing, reporting and overall operations.
Responsibilities:
EPIC Broker and Client Management
Working with the EPIC Pharmacy Benefit Consultant, EPIC Broker, client, PBM, and EPIC resources the candidate will:
• Supports the EPIC Account Team supporting clients with clients and EPIC Brokers
• Participate in ongoing client meetings including:
o PBM implementation support
o Vendor review meetings
o Independent strategy and performance assessment meetings
• Navigate appropriate internal EPIC experts on custom projects and analyses. Ensuring deadlines are met and projects are completed on time.
• Manage client renewals in collaboration with the Pharmacy Benefit Consulting Team
• Comply with all PSG policies and procedures including protection of PSG’s assets, data security, confidentiality, privacy and processing integrity
• Become a product expert/SME on PSG’s internal technology and internal reporting capabilities
• Perform basic analytics related to client program performance
• Prepare and support the delivery of quarterly and annual business reviews with clients and pharmacy partners to highlight program performance and outline optimization opportunities
• Monitor PSG billing activity related to assigned accounts to ensure accuracy and timely billing
• Maintain Client Relationship Management (CRM) documentation to assigned accounts
Program and Business Development
• Assess opportunity for expanding EPIC Pharmacy Solution services within existing client relationship.
• Participation in conferences and other forums for showcasing program experience and success.
• Participate in internal workgroups to develop new programs, services, corporate positions and publications based on the continual assessment of client and market needs.
Account Implementation
• Assists Pharmacy Benefit Consultant by providing oversight, guidance and serve as an advocate for the broker and client to ensure vendor requirements are being met and service levels are adequate throughout vendor implementation.
• Identify issues and concerns for appropriate escalation and resolution to ensure successful transition.
RFP Process Management
• Participate in general RFI/RFP process via scoring and assistance with this annual process.
Qualifications (Minimum Requirements)
• Extensive knowledge of PBM and specialty pharmacy environment (2 years minimum experience).
• Strong verbal and written communication skills including presentation skills and client relationship management experience.
• Strong experience with Broker, TPA and Captive markets
• Strong analysis skills including: Word, PowerPoint and Excel
• Detail oriented and self-directed
• Willingness to be part of a team unit and cooperate in the accomplishment and departmental and organizational goals and objectives
• Travel is required, but typically less than 20%
• Pharmacy benefits background with bachelor’s degree; MBA preferred
